Transaction 4e773314dedc7a48b303a66b4333bfff5bc77080f00eb6aaee027267bbe1236c

28 Input
1 Outputs
  • 4e773314dedc7a48b303a66b4333bfff5bc77080f00eb6aaee027267bbe1236c:0
  • value  2125495
    address  38KApS5UQLrFftNLKDVDudSowPywMEvyVS